Abstract

Sleep quality is very beneficial for the human body, but sometimes it is hampered by bad activities such as playing online games that will make you addicted. Addiction to online games will make health disturbed. Teenagers who are addicted to online games have decreased physical strength due to a lack of physical movement and lack of sleep. This study aims to determine the effect of online game addiction on sleep quality in class VIII students of MTS Ma'arif Kaliwiro, Wonosobo. This type of research is a quantitative observational method using a cross-sectional approach and using a total sampling of 38 students of class VIII MTS Ma'arif Kaliwiro, Wonosobo. The results of the Spearman Rank test obtained a p-value of 0.000, which means p-value <0.05, which means that online game addiction influences sleep quality in class VIII adolescents at MTS Ma'arif Kaliwiro, Wonosobo with a correlation coefficient of 0.638. which means the strength of the relationship is strong. It is hoped that the results of this study can increase respondents' understanding of the importance of managing time to play online games so that sleep quality can be maintained properly.
